Clear Armor’s funding support aligns closely with the types of organizations we serve and the projects we install. Examples include:
- Churches and faith-based organizations pursuing Nonprofit Security Grant Program (NSGP) funding for bullet-resistant windows at entrances, sanctuaries, and offices.
- Nonprofit private schools using NSGP and supporting programs to harden front offices and administrative areas.
- Public school districts leveraging School Violence Prevention Program (SVPP) or State Homeland Security Program (SHSP) funds for front office ballistic glazing.
- Public safety agencies using SHSP or Urban Area Security Initiative (UASI) funding for protective windows at public counters, lobbies, and dispatch-adjacent spaces.
- Rural schools and public safety facilities accessing USDA Community Facilities financing for large-scale, facility-wide security upgrades.
